**Spain Esophageal Squamous Cell Carcinoma Market Drivers**

**Increasing Incidence of Esophageal Squamous Cell Carcinoma**

The startling increase in the frequency of esophageal cancer is driving substantial expansion in the Spain Esophageal Squamous Cell Carcinoma Market Industry. According to the Spanish Society of Medical Oncology, there were over 7,000 new instances of esophageal cancer recorded each year between 2020 and 2022. Environmental risk factors, including alcohol and tobacco use, which are known to raise the incidence of esophageal squamous cell carcinoma, are in line with this increasing trend. 

Furthermore, Spain would be affected by the World Health Organization's and other health organizations' predictions of a constant rise in cancer incidence worldwide. Consequently, it is anticipated that the market will continue to expand due to the increased need for sophisticated diagnostic instruments and efficient treatment alternatives. The Spain Esophageal Squamous Cell Carcinoma Market Industry offers a plethora of prospects for expansion and innovation in light of these variables.

Endoscopy (Dominant) vs. CT Scan (Emerging)

Endoscopy is recognized as the dominant diagnostic tool in the segment, celebrated for its ability to provide direct visualization of the esophagus and obtain tissue samples for histopathological evaluation. Its established efficacy in early detection makes it the preferred choice among clinicians. In contrast, CT Scan is emerging rapidly as a significant diagnostic alternative, driven by technological advancements that improve visualization and diagnostic accuracy. This method offers detailed cross-sectional images and is less invasive compared to traditional approaches, appealing to both patients and healthcare providers. The shift toward this emerging technology signifies a broader trend towards enhanced, non-invasive diagnostic solutions in the Spain esophageal squamous-cell-carcinoma market.

Surgery (Dominant) vs. Immunotherapy (Emerging)

Surgery remains the dominant treatment modality in the Spain esophageal squamous-cell-carcinoma market, primarily due to its well-established efficacy in resecting tumors, thus providing the best chance for patients with early-stage disease. Surgeons utilize advanced techniques, including minimally invasive approaches, to improve recovery times and overall outcomes. On the other hand, immunotherapy is emerging as a crucial treatment option, especially for advanced stages where traditional approaches may falter. This modality harnesses the body's immune system to target and destroy cancer cells, representing a significant shift in therapeutic strategies. As clinical trials continue to demonstrate favorable results, immunotherapy is set to enhance treatment paradigms and attract a larger patient base seeking innovative treatment options.
